Amarea Helsen, Tower Accepted and apprentice to the Brown Ajah will be leading a class this week on Far Madding. This class will provide an in-depth look at the history of the city-state of Far Madding, spanning from the Age of Legends to the modern day. Key historical events from each epoch of time will be reviewed, as well as their implication for Far Madding's culture. The class will culminate in a field trip to Far Madding itself, including a tour of points of interests in the city and their historical significance. Amarea says 'First, we have the calendar created by Toma dur Ahmid, which was adopted about two centuries after the death of the last known male Aes Sedai. The Toman calendar records dates in years After the Breaking of the World, or AB, and was used until the Trolloc Wars ended about 1,350 years later.'
Amarea says 'Second, a scholar by the name of Tiam of Gazar created a new calendar to herald the end of the deadly Trolloc Wars. The Gazaran calendar marked dates in years since the assumed end of the Trolloc threat, more simply known as Free Years, or FY.'
Amarea says 'Finally, the Farede calendar that you all know and use in the present day was invented by a Sea Folk scholar named Uren din Jubai Soaring Gull. This calendar was widely adopted in approximately FY 1135, after the War of the Hundred Years and the end of Artur Hawkwing's empire. This calendar marks years of the New Era, or NE.'

Amarea says 'Essenia did not have a single monarch, but was ruled by a noble oligarchy. In other words, a coalition of nobles who had largely equal power and duties were responsible for leadin' the country. They were guided by their First Lord, who from the records was believed to be a first among equals.'

Amarea says 'Initially, the Ten Nations fought valiantly and repelled the Dreadlords and their armies of Shadowspawn. In the time of the Trolloc Wars, however, the Ten Nations had separate armies that primarily utilized a "home rule" under their national leaders.'
Amarea says 'This meant that as each nation in turn faced hordes of Trollocs, the neighborin' nations were cautious to send out their forces beyond their borders to help, out of fear that they would have no forces left to defend their own people. This principle of war greatly strained the Compact and weakened their efforts over time.'

Amarea says 'These nations had overextended their forces. Over the next 50 to 150 years, all of these nations but Tar Valon gradually fell apart and disintegrated into 29 new, smaller nations or city-states.'
Amarea says 'Essenia, specifically, fell in the aftermath of the Battle of Maighande and gave birth to the nations of Esandara, Fergansea, Moreina, and Talmour, with Esandara includin' Fel Moreina, the city that would later become Far Madding.'

Amarea says 'As previously discussed, in approximately 1350 AB, during the strife caused by the dissolution and formin' of so many nations, the Gazaran calendar was widely adopted throughout the Westlands at the beginnin' of what is referred to today as the Free Years epoch, or the time seemingly marked by freedom from the Trolloc threat.'
Amarea says 'Now, much of the history of Far Madding is relatively quiet for nearly a millennium at the start of the Free Years epoch. This all ended in FY 939, when the infamous man by the name of Guaire Amalasan declared himself as the Dragon Reborn in the nation of Darmovan, which includes modern day Falme and Katar.'
Amarea says 'Over the next four years, Amalasan waged what is referred to as the War of the Second Dragon when he and his "Children of the Dragon" cut a large swath across the western and southern nations of the Westlands, claiming between one third and one half of the continent, including Esandara in FY 939.'
Perenelle arches an eyebrow.
Amarea says 'The histories suggest that Esandara's capital by this time may have been named Far Madding, although I found another reference that suggested it was still Fel Moreina. Amalasan laid siege to the city and claimed it in three weeks. However, he was later beaten in a decisive victory by Artur Paendrag Tanreall in FY 943 at the Battle of the Jolvaine Pass.'
Amarea says 'Over the next 20 years, a series of events largely outside the scope of this class led to the War of the Consolidation, ending in FY 963 when Panreall, known by this time as Artur Hawkwing, was declared the High King of the Westlands, which were united under a single empire.'
Amarea says 'Hawkwing's death in FY 994, at which time he had no surviving heir for a variety of reasons, plunged the Westlands into chaos. His empire disintegrated as one by one, nations around the continent claimed independence, including Andor, Cairhien, Tear, and the five Borderland provinces: Arafel, Kandor, Malkier, Saldaea, and Shienar.'
Amarea says 'Thus began the War of the Hundred Years, so named because it spanned over approximately 130 years, brought about by the collapse of his empire.'

Amarea says 'The nation of Maredo was founded by Lady Danella Mathendrin, who claimed all of the Plains of Maredo and part of modern day Murandy, and Far Madding was its capital. Notably, Maredo was a matriarchal nation, and the Counsels of Far Madding served as political advisors to the queen.'

Amarea says 'All visitors in the city are required by Far Madding law to remove their weapons. Historically, being seen with a drawn weapon would get you thrown immediately in jail. The Wall Guard have relaxed their laws somewhat, but your bladed weapons will be "peace bonded" upon entry, and the guards will know if you have drawn them from their scabbard.'
Amarea says 'Far Madding has a foreign policy with predominant tenets of nationalism and conservatism. They are especially conservative with regards to views about the One Power and channelers, with the roots of this policy possibly traceable all the way back to Aren Deshar and groups such as the enclave of the Incastar, as we discussed.'

Amarea says 'We are enterin' here through the Caemlyn Gate. The city has three entrances, and its three gates reflect the direction towards their neighboring modern day nations: Caemlyn Gate to the north, Illian Gate to the southwest, and Tear Gate to the southeast.'
Amarea says 'The city-state is located on an island in the middle of a lake, connected to the surrounding mainland by three bridges, including the Ajalon Bridge to the north, the Ikane Bridge to the southwest, and the Goim Bridge to the southeast.'

Amarea says 'This is one of three Strangers' Markets in the city. Far Madding has three of these, named so because foreigners, or strangers to the city, are only allowed to trade in one of these three marketplaces. Each of them is named after one of the prominent First Counsels in Far Madding's history, this one being named after Einion Ahvarin.'

Amarea says 'Far Madding is the birthplace of at least three previous Amyrlins. Sareille Bagand, who passed away in 890 NE, was originally of the White Ajah. Aleis Romlin, who died in 922 NE and was Bagand's successor, was originally of the Green Ajah. And Cadsuane Melaihdrin, also of the Green Ajah, stepped down in 1328 NE (2/24/20) amidst criticism about how she guided the Tower against the False Dragon Bardomir Lazar.'
Maddy nods in agreement.
Amarea says 'Three other Aes Sedai born in Far Madding include Verin Mathwin and Escaralde Hamdey of the Brown Ajah, and Romanda Cassin of the Yellow Ajah.'

Amarea says 'As you can see, the ter'angreal consists of three large discs. The first prevents use of saidar within the city limits. The second prevents use of saidin for about a mile around the city. The third does not prevent channelin', but it does locate use of the One Power through a fascinatin' triangulation process.'

Amarea says 'As you can see, the wedges of this third disc will pivot to point towards the location of channelin' within several miles of the city. They glow red when they detect saidar, and black when they detect saidin. The stone around the rings has numerals that can be used to calculate an exact distance to the channeler when you cross-reference them.'
